Below are the details of the Vessel, weather condition, damage incurred and other accident details such as the date: During a docking manoeuvre under the conduct of a pilot and assisted by two tugs, the main engine failed to start and the bulbous bow of the vessel struck the dock causing ingress of water in the fore peak.
